Heavy Rain and Flash Flooding in the West; Heat Expands in the Central U.S.

Monsoonal moisture will produce showers and thunderstorms with heavy rain over parts of the Southwest, Great Basin, and Central Rockies through Monday. Flash flooding is possible, especially in and around burn scars and in areas of steep terrain.
